Position description

POSITION: Field Work Consultant/Project Coordinator, Fiscal Year (11 month), 100% time

OVERVIEW: Responsible for the operation and implementation of practicum education experiences for students that focus on the delivery of the Council on Social Work Education competencies and Youth Behavioral Health competencies. Includes the development of educational programs for students and collaboration and coordination with public and private agencies in Los Angeles, and surrounding counties. Candidate will be expected to teach courses and to support the recruitment of students for stipend training programs. Requires expertise in youth and young adult behavioral health and will focus on a new privately funded stipend program.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

* Coordinates a new stipend training program and monitor adherence to grant responsibilities
* Develops new and on-going training modules for youth and young adult behavioral health competencies with a particular focus on grassroots community agencies and culturally resonant methods.
* Consults with practicum agency practicum instructors and/or preceptors to develop internship sites for students.
* Identifies, develops, and provides training, seminars and other practicum work support that focus on the delivery of the assigned program's competencies.
* Works and collaborates with the Principal Investigator, Director of Practicum Education, and other Practicum Education Faculty to plan and implement educational experiences and activities for the practicum education program.
* Facilitates and functions as practicum faculty in assigned practicum seminar, student orientation and practicum instructor trainings. Interprets school policies and requirements; monitors and evaluates students' progress; advises assigned program students; evaluates practicum instructors and agency's performance; mediates problems and/or disputes.
* Contributes to relevant written materials as needed, e.g. practicum manual, learning agreements, school policies that impact the practicum education curriculum and support the internships.
* Monitors and evaluates liability, malpractice, and risk management issues for students and agencies. Provide due process, input, and feedback for agencies, practicum instructors, and students.
* Participates in departmental committees, curriculum development and special projects, as assigned.
* Teaches in the MSW program.
